Quality Control: The Difference is in the Details
When you buy a genuine luxury bag, you are paying for heritage, innovation, and uncompromising craftsmanship. Brands spend centuries perfecting their leather tanning processes, hardware plating, and stitching techniques.
When a replica is produced, the focus shifts from longevity and perfection to efficient mass production. Even the best replicas ultimately cut corners somewhere to maintain a profitable price point.
In my experience, you can usually spot the difference by focusing on three specific areas:
Genuine high-end bags use full-grain or top-grain leather that has been treated meticulously. It develops a gorgeous patina over time, smells rich (not chemical), and feels supple. Replicas often use PU leather, bonded leather, or lower-quality genuine leather that is chemically treated to mask imperfections. They can feel stiff, smell strongly of glue or dye, and crack rather than soften.

The Ethical Crossroads: Beyond Aspiration
This is where the conversation gets serious. While the decision to purchase a replica might seem like a harmless transaction between an individual and a seller on the internet, the replica market is intrinsically tied to larger, darker issues.
Buying counterfeits directly supports the illegal market. Funds generated from the sale of replicas are frequently funneled into organized crime, including drug trafficking, money laundering, and, most disturbingly, forced labor and chanel boy bag replica shop unsafe working conditions.
When we see a ridiculously low price for a product that mimics high luxury, we have to ask ourselves: who is paying the real cost?
The designer bags we admire are protected by intellectual property laws. Counterfeiting is theft—it steals the creativity, revenue, and brand integrity from the companies and the designers who poured their careers into those innovations.

Q: What is the difference between a “dupe” and a “replica”?
A: A replica (or counterfeit) tries to deceive buyers by copying the brand name, logo, and unique identifiers of the original designer replica bags. A dupe (or inspired design) copies the general silhouette or aesthetic but uses its own distinct branding and logo, making it a legal and ethically clearer purchase.
